The newspaper placard [PDF]
Science and the Newspapers
Interviews newspapers
Portsmouth Newspapers
Newspapers in 1680 [PDF]
Newspaper English
Newspaper Fare
Newspapers and Newspaper Readers in London
SCIENCE AND THE NEWSPAPERS
Electronic Newspapers